If the amount of boyz is a concern, you could drop a dread and some lootas(drop 10 and take them down to 5 each) for another unit.

Honestly, on second inspection, with the 2k list, I'd be tempted to group the lootas as 15, 5, 5. One fearless to start. The rest in optimal small unit, requiring 2 wounds to force a morale test, and with the chance of losing very few models. Obviously, the 15 squad would be targeted, but currently, those 8's only need 2 wounds to force a test, same as a group of 5. Dropping 10 lootas and a dread would give you your perfect 235 points for another unit of the boyz.

Ninety boyz is about all you will want to play game in and game out, believe me. It's a nightmare moving a 100+ models a turn - says the guy who plays two Green Tides in Apocalypse. Plus there isn't room for that many models unless you play on at least an 8'x4' table.

A squad of Grots isn't a bad idea. They can hide in reserve for as long as possible and then stroll to an objective. They will give you a fourth troop that won't require as much attention as a squad of boyz and won't tie up as many points babysitting an objective.
